Match Report

Hereford United's brave fightback proved too little too late as Cardiff City moved into the fifth round of the FA Cup.

Star man for the Bluebirds was full-back Kevin McNaughton, who scored the first and earned a penalty for Steven Thompson to extend the lead before Theo Robinson gave Hereford hope.

There was almost a dramatic start to the tie with former Bulls winger Paul Parry at the heart of the action.

The Wales international fired in a shot which was brilliantly turned around the post by goalkeeper Wayne Brown.

Parry continued to pose a threat with a couple of other early shots.

McNaughton had a great chance in the 20th minute when he got around the back of the Hereford defence only to shoot into the side-netting when a cross would have served him better.

But Hereford grew in confidence as the half went on and also had their moments.

Robinson had a shot well saved by Michael Oakes and Ben Smith had the ball taken off his toe as he rounded the Cardiff keeper.

But in the second minute of first-half injury time, a long throw by former Bulls loanee Tony Capaldi was half cleared to the edge of the area and McNaughton scored with dipping shot which Brown did not appear to see.

McNaughton had a big part to play when the Bluebirds extended their lead in the 67th minute.

He surged into the area but was pulled down by substitute Clint Easton, allowing Thompson to crack his penalty into the corner of the net.

Hereford showed plenty of battle and commitment and gave themselves a lifeline when Robinson raced onto a Smith pass to crack home his 13th goal of the season.

It took good saves by Oakes from Toumani Diagouraga and Simon Johnson to see his side into the last 16 as Hereford threw caution to the wind late on.
